I. Technical Core: The Foundation from One-Way Display to Two-Way Interaction

The rise of floor-standing LED touch displays is rooted in the maturity and integration of multiple display and interaction technologies. At its core is the combination of high-quality visual performance with sensitive and stable touch operation.

In terms of display, modern floor-standing devices generally adopt LED-backlit LCD panels, offering full HD 1920×1080 or even 4K resolution, with brightness reaching 300–450 cd/㎡ or higher. This ensures clear, vivid images in various lighting environments such as shopping malls and exhibition halls. The high-brightness design effectively resists ambient light interference even in outdoor or brightly lit indoor areas (e.g., school playgrounds), maintaining excellent visibility. Some high-end models use industrial-grade backlight modules and intelligent temperature control systems, guaranteeing stability and long service life during long-term continuous operation or in harsh environments ranging from -20℃ to 50℃.

For interaction, infrared touch and G+G (glass+glass) touch technologies dominate. Infrared touch features high precision, stability, light-touch operation, and compatibility with any touching object, making it ideal for high-frequency, high-traffic public environments. G+G touch solutions deliver higher light transmittance and touch accuracy for smoother, premium user experiences. These technologies support single-point and over 10-point multi-touch, enabling gestures like zoom, drag, and swipe, laying the groundwork for rich interactive applications.

Powerful hardware and intelligent systems form the “brain” behind its all-in-one functionality. Equipped with high-performance processors (such as Intel i3 or ARM chips), sufficient memory and storage, and running Android, Windows, or custom embedded operating systems, these devices smoothly play high-definition videos and images while stably running complex interactive query software. They process user input and provide instant feedback, truly shifting the experience from passive viewing to active exploration.


II. Functional Integration: Core Value of an All-In-One Solution

The integration of “interactive query + advertising playback” is not a simple combination of functions, but a deep software-hardware integration that creates a “1+1>2” application value. This integration manifests in three dimensions: content management, interface presentation, and data linkage.

For content management and distribution, modern floor-standing touch displays widely adopt a cloud+terminal architecture with an intelligent Content Management System (CMS). Administrators can remotely, centrally, and batch update content and schedule programs for devices deployed in different locations via local or wide-area networks. For example, brand headquarters can synchronize new product advertisements or promotions to all store terminals nationwide with one click, ensuring consistent and timely marketing messaging. The system supports timed, periodical, looped, and inserted playback modes, automatically switching content based on preset strategies for refined operations.

In interface presentation, powerful split-screen functionality is key. A single screen can be divided into multiple independent zones to display different types of content simultaneously. For instance, the main area plays brand videos in a loop, the sidebar shows real-time weather, news, or promotions, and the bottom remains a fixed interactive query entry. This design allows advertising exposure and functional services to coexist without interference, maximizing screen space usage and providing users with richer information layers.

In data and functional linkage, all-in-one machines are evolving from independent terminals to scenario hubs. Through rich interfaces (USB, HDMI, RJ45, etc.) and built-in systems, they can connect to peripherals such as printers, scanners, and cameras, or integrate with enterprise back-end systems like ERP and CRM. For example, in furniture stores, consumers can check product details, inventory, and even simulate matching effects via the touch screen; in government service halls, it integrates queuing, inquiry, form-filling, and printing to greatly improve efficiency. Such deep integration elevates it beyond a simple advertising or query tool to an intelligent node that empowers business processes and enhances user experience.


III. Application Scenarios and Future Trends

All-in-one floor-standing touch displays are highly adaptable and have penetrated various industries. In retail (furniture stores, shopping malls), they serve as eye-catching advertising showcases and shopping assistants for product details, virtual try-on, and self-service ordering. In public services (government halls, hospitals, museums), they undertake information release, service guidance, self-service inquiry, and cultural display. In education and exhibitions, they support interactive learning, event information display, achievement presentations, and virtual guided tours.

Looking ahead, development will focus on intelligence and ecologization. On one hand, AI integration will endow devices with stronger perception and analysis capabilities. Equipped with cameras and sensors, they can realize face recognition, passenger flow statistics, and behavior analysis to deliver personalized advertisements and services. AI voice interaction provides a more natural and convenient operation method, expanding the user base.


Integration with the Internet of Things (IoT) and Augmented Reality (AR) will open new possibilities. Devices can link with lighting, audio, air conditioning, and other environmental facilities to create immersive atmospheres based on content. AR allows users to preview virtual products in real environments via the screen, greatly enhancing interaction and purchase confidence.
